Trump threatens $5bn lawsuit over liberal national guard policy report

21 août 2026 à 19:49

A report released by thinktank Cap argues the deployment of the national guard failed to have a measurable impact on crime, despite costing billions

The Center for American Progress (Cap) received a letter from Donald Trump’s lawyer threatening a $5bn lawsuit unless the liberal research organization retracts a report criticizing the effectiveness of the president’s National Guard rollout.

The report released 13 July argues that the National Guard deployment in Washington DC, Memphis and Los Angeles failed to have a measurable impact on crime in these cities despite an estimated cost of $1.7bn. The report looks at the falling rate of crime in cities without a National Guard intervention and concludes that they are not statistically different from the rate of decrease in those that had the intervention, noting that violent crime began falling well before Trump took office in 2025.

US Senator Tim Sheehy, a Montana Republican and a cattle rancher, has come out against a plan announced Friday by Donald Trump to allow for an increase in imported ground beef.

”I’ve advised President Trump against this course of action for a year because American ranchers have been struggling against the packer monopoly for decades, and this will further harm them - most of whom are MAGA Republicans,” Sheehy wrote on X. “The President’s heart is in the right place on wanting lower prices for the American people, and beef prices have been impacted by the Mexican screwworm. But the reality is this action will make it more difficult for American ranchers to rebuild our herd and bring prices down for the American people. And most importantly, this will harm our ranching families who feed the nation.”

Trump announced a plan on Truth Social to allow 300,000 metric tonnes of beef to be imported without tariffs over the next 90 days, to be sold for hamburger at a 25 percent discount to current prices. Trump offered this agreement with an unnamed source as measure to lower prices while “as we work to rebuild this herd and help our ranchers.”

The US beef cattle herd is near historic lows, and beef prices have skyrocketed over the last year. The average price of ground beef in American cities is around $7.12 a pound, an increase of 9.4 percent year-over-year according to the Bureau of Labor Statistics.

An FBI team seized electronic devices from former US representative Eric Swalwell at the San Francisco airport on Saturday, then raided his home in Washington, DC, the next day, CNN reported Thursday.

The raid is part of a federal investigation into the sexual assault allegations which ultimately drove the Bay Area Democrat to resign from office in April, sources familiar with the investigation told CNN. The Manhattan District Attorney’s Office and the Los Angeles Sheriff’s Department subsequently opened criminal investigations on Swalwell.

Those unfamiliar with Alaska politics are likely raising an eyebrow at some repeated names.

No, we’re not talking about Dan S Sullivan and Dan J Sullivan, two Republicans with the same name running for US Senate – an issue that went to the state supreme court earlier this summer. We’re talking about the Begiches. Nick Begich III, a Republican, is currently leading the race to represent Alaska in the US House of Representatives for a second term while Tom Begich, a Democrat, is advancing to the general election for governor in November.

President Donald Trump posted an image of a map of the strait of Hormuz on his social media platform Truth Social, with a circle around the strait and the words “New US Territory” as the title on Tuesday morning.

This follows comments made on Friday at a speech at a police academy on Long Island, New York, where Trump said “After we finish defeating Iran, which is being very badly defeated, pretty soon I’ll be declaring the Hormuz strait a territory of the United States. … Essentially, that’s what it is. We have the blockade. No ships get through unless we want them to.”
